Room hire

If you’re looking for a place to run an event, meeting, training session, community group, workshop or 1-1 activities (such as counselling), Luton All Women’s Centre at The Spires has a range of rooms available to hire.

Conveniently located in Luton Town Centre, The Spires is easy to get to with ample nearby parking facilities. Find us HERE.

All proceeds from room hire go towards the work we undertake at our centre to support women from the local community.

Refreshments

Tea/ Coffee and biscuits are provided with all room bookings.

We do not have any on-site catering facilities. External catering can be organised on your behalf, the cost of which will be confirmed per booking and is subject to your requirements.

Equipment hire

Additional equipment is chargeable as follows:

  • Flip chart and stand, pens and paper - £2.50 per hour or £10 per day
  • Projector - £5 per hour or £30 per day (please note, to connect to a projector you will need to bring your own laptop)

Terms and Conditions

When a room is booked at The Spires, LAWC agrees to:

  • Ensure that the room is prepared and ready for use at the beginning of the hire time.
  • Ensure a member of the LAWC team is available to provide access to the building and deal with any queries that ay occur throughout the hire period.

When a room is booked at The Spires, the Hirer agrees to:

  • Abide by all relevant fire and health and safety regulations and requirements.
  • Be mindful and respectful of the fact that LAWC clients may be in the building during the time of room hire.
  • Leave the room in the condition in which it was found.
  • Give 14 days’ notice to cancel any booking. If a booking is cancelled without 14 days’ notice or in the case of a ‘no show’ the hirer will be liable to pay the full booking cost.

Payment:

  • LAWC will normally invoice for room hire within 1 month of the room hire date. Invoices must be paid within 14 days.
  • No room hire bookings will be taken where a hirer has an outstanding invoice.
